を備えたことを特徴とする眼科用レーザ治療装置。 A laser irradiation optical system for irradiating a patient's eye with a treatment laser beam emitted from a treatment laser light source;
A scanning means provided in the laser irradiation optical system for two-dimensionally scanning the spot of the treatment laser light on the tissue of the patient's eye;
Pattern irradiating means for forming a spot of a predetermined pattern using the laser irradiation optical system and the scanning means;
Motion detection means for detecting motion of the patient's eye;
Determination means for determining whether to continue forming the spot of the predetermined pattern based on the detection result of the motion detection means during formation of the spot of the predetermined pattern;
An ophthalmic laser treatment apparatus comprising:
撮影光学系と受光素子を有し、前記撮影光学系と前記受光素子を用いて前記患者眼の撮影画像を得る撮影手段を備え、
前記動き検出手段は前記撮影画像を解析して前記患者眼の動きを検出する、
ことを特徴とする眼科用レーザ治療装置。 The ophthalmic laser treatment apparatus according to claim 1 is
It comprises a photographing optical system and a light receiving element, and comprises photographing means for obtaining a photographed image of the patient's eye using the photographing optical system and the light receiving element,
The motion detection means analyzes the captured image to detect motion of the patient's eye.
An ophthalmic laser treatment apparatus characterized in that
前記パターン照射手段による前記所定パターンのスポットの形成途中において前記レーザ照射光学系の変位を検出する変位検出手段を備え、A displacement detection unit configured to detect a displacement of the laser irradiation optical system during formation of the spot of the predetermined pattern by the pattern irradiation unit;
前記決定手段は更に、前記変位検出手段の検出結果を用いて前記継続するか否かを決定する、The determination means further determines whether to continue using the detection result of the displacement detection means.
ことを特徴とする眼科用レーザ治療装置。An ophthalmic laser treatment apparatus characterized in that
前記レーザ照射光学系の少なくとも一部を支持する支持部材にはモーションセンサーが組み付けられており、A motion sensor is attached to a support member that supports at least a part of the laser irradiation optical system,
前記変位検出手段は前記モーションセンサーの出力信号を用いて前記レーザ照射光学系の変位を検出する、The displacement detection means detects a displacement of the laser irradiation optical system using an output signal of the motion sensor.
ことを特徴とする眼科用レーザ治療装置。An ophthalmic laser treatment apparatus characterized in that
前記治療レーザ光により前記患者眼の眼底に光凝固のスポットを形成する、Forming a spot of photocoagulation on the fundus of the patient's eye by the treatment laser light;
ことを特徴とする眼科用レーザ治療装置。An ophthalmic laser treatment apparatus characterized in that
